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- wget http://www.c-nergy.be/downloads/tigervncserver_1.6.80-4_amd64.zip
- unzip tigervncserver_1.6.80-4_amd64.zip
- dpkg -i tigervncserver_1.6.80-4_amd64.deb
- apt-get install -f
- wget https://github.com/neutrinolabs/xrdp/archive/v0.9.1.zip
- unzip v0.9.1.zip
- cd xrdp-0.9.1/
- sudo apt-get -y install autoconf libtool libpam0g-dev libx11-dev libxfixes-dev libssl-dev libxrandr-dev
- sudo apt-get -y update
- apt-get upgrade
- sudo apt-get -y install xrdp
- sudo apt-get -y remove xrdp
- sudo sed -i.bak 's/which libtool/which libtoolize/g' bootstrap
- sudo ./bootstrap
- sudo ./configure
- sudo make
- sudo make install
- sudo sed -i.bak '/\[xrdp1\]/i [xrdp0] \nname=Xvnc-Sesman-Griffon \nlib=libvnc.so \nusername=ask \npassword=ask \nip=127.0.0.1 \nport=-1 \ndelay_ms=2000' /etc/xrdp/xrdp.ini
- sudo mv /etc/xrdp/startwm.sh /etc/xrdp/startwm.sh.backup
- sudo ln -s /etc/X11/Xsession /etc/xrdp/startwm.sh
- sudo mkdir /usr/share/doc/xrdp
- sudo cp /etc/xrdp/rsakeys.ini /usr/share/doc/xrdp/rsakeys.ini
- sudo sed -i.bak 's/EnvironmentFile/#EnvironmentFile/g' /lib/systemd/system/xrdp.service
- sudo sed -i.bak 's/sbin\/xrdp/local\/sbin\/xrdp/g' /lib/systemd/system/xrdp.service
- sudo sed -i.bak 's/EnvironmentFile/#EnvironmentFile/g' /lib/systemd/system/xrdp-sesman.service
- sudo sed -i.bak 's/sbin\/xrdp/local\/sbin\/xrdp/g' /lib/systemd/system/xrdp-sesman.service
- sudo systemctl daemon-reload
- sudo systemctl enable xrdp.service
- ###From Console
- cd /etc/xrdp
- setxkbmap -layout us
- sudo cp /etc/xrdp/km-0409.ini /etc/xrdp/km-0409.ini.bak
- sudo xrdp-genkeymap km-0409.ini
- ###
- sudo sed -i.bak '/fi/a #xrdp multi-users \n unity \n' /etc/xrdp/startwm.sh
- init 6
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ement